Openize.AForge pour .NET
Simplifiez le traitement des images avec l'API .NET
Éditez facilement les images avec Openize.AForge, une API légère et open source pour .NET
Openize.AForge pour .NET Il s'agit d'un fork du AForge.Net, qui inclut la bibliothèque Imaging. Cette version a été traduite dans le framework NetStandard 2.0 et utilise Aspose.Drawing comme moteur graphique, ce qui vous permet pour créer des applications multiplateformes en utilisant les dernières plateformes .Net.
Openize.AForge est disponible sous licences :
Openize.AForge est distribué sous licence LGPL.
Aspose.Drawing .NET est distribué sous Aspose Licence CLUF.
Principales caractéristiques et avantages- Multiplateforme :Grâce à l'intégration avec Aspose.Drawing, la bibliothèque peut fonctionner avec des images sur les dernières versions de .Net sur les plateformes Windows, Linux et MacOS
Comment démarrer avec Openize.AForge pour .NET
Démarrer avec Openize.AForge est simple et rapide. Suivez simplement ces étapes :
- Installer Openize.AForge : installez le package Openize.AForge via NuGet Package Manager ou .NET CLI.
- Intégrez-vous à votre projet : référencez la bibliothèque Openize.AForge dans votre projet C#.
- Démarrer le traitement : utilisez l'API simple fournie par Openize.AForge pour le traitement des images.
La méthode recommandée pour installer Openize.AForge pour .NET consiste à utiliser NuGet. Veuillez utiliser la commande suivante pour une installation fluide.
Installer Openize.AForge pour .NET via NuGet
NuGet> Install-Package Openize.AForge
Vous pouvez également le télécharger directement depuis GitHub.Appliquer un filtre en niveaux de gris en C#
Ce code convertit l'image au format niveaux de gris.
Copiez et collez l'extrait de code ci-dessous dans votre fichier principal et exécutez le programme.
Convertir l'image au format niveaux de gris
//Set License for Aspose.Drawing
System.Drawing.AsposeDrawing.License license = new System.Drawing.AsposeDrawing.License();
license.SetLicense("Aspose.Drawing.License.lic");
//Create grayscale filter
var grayscaleFilter = new Openize.AForge.Imaging.Filters.Grayscale(0.2126, 0.7152, 0.0722);
//open image
using (var bmp = (Bitmap)Image.FromFile(@"sample.bmp"))
//convert image to grayscale
using (var grayscaleImage = grayscaleFilter.Apply(bmp))
{
//save grayscale image
grayscaleImage.Save(@"grayscale.png", ImageFormat.Png);
}
Vous pouvez voir d'autres exemples directement sur le site AForge.
- Multiplateforme :Grâce à l'intégration avec Aspose.Drawing, la bibliothèque peut fonctionner avec des images sur les dernières versions de .Net sur les plateformes Windows, Linux et MacOS
Comment démarrer avec Openize.AForge pour .NET
Démarrer avec Openize.AForge est simple et rapide. Suivez simplement ces étapes :
- Installer Openize.AForge : installez le package Openize.AForge via NuGet Package Manager ou .NET CLI.
- Intégrez-vous à votre projet : référencez la bibliothèque Openize.AForge dans votre projet C#.
- Démarrer le traitement : utilisez l'API simple fournie par Openize.AForge pour le traitement des images.
La méthode recommandée pour installer Openize.AForge pour .NET consiste à utiliser NuGet. Veuillez utiliser la commande suivante pour une installation fluide.
Installer Openize.AForge pour .NET via NuGet
NuGet> Install-Package Openize.AForge
Vous pouvez également le télécharger directement depuis GitHub.Appliquer un filtre en niveaux de gris en C#
Ce code convertit l'image au format niveaux de gris.
Copiez et collez l'extrait de code ci-dessous dans votre fichier principal et exécutez le programme.
Convertir l'image au format niveaux de gris
//Set License for Aspose.Drawing
System.Drawing.AsposeDrawing.License license = new System.Drawing.AsposeDrawing.License();
license.SetLicense("Aspose.Drawing.License.lic");
//Create grayscale filter
var grayscaleFilter = new Openize.AForge.Imaging.Filters.Grayscale(0.2126, 0.7152, 0.0722);
//open image
using (var bmp = (Bitmap)Image.FromFile(@"sample.bmp"))
//convert image to grayscale
using (var grayscaleImage = grayscaleFilter.Apply(bmp))
{
//save grayscale image
grayscaleImage.Save(@"grayscale.png", ImageFormat.Png);
}
Vous pouvez voir d'autres exemples directement sur le site AForge.